              The season is 13 games in.

              The difference between 4th seed and last in east is 3.5 games.

              There are a lot of teams not tanking but suffering from injuries or chemistry issues. In the East only teams likely to be tanking are Boston, Orlando, and Philly. Milwaukee has injuries and an owner who values a first round exit ($). Brooklyn has 2 starters and a key reserve out and still adjusting to the new roster. New York has 2 starters out. DeTroit, Charlotte, Cleveland, and Washington are all trying to make the playoffs this year - they are not tanking. In the West you have Utah outright tanking and Sacramento are bad - but trying to get better.

              The Raptors don't have to have the worst record to get a top pick in the draft. Even the team with the worst record is only guaranteed a 25% shot at #1.
